Deepwater Platform Deployment for Black Sea Natural Gas Processing
OMV Petrom and SNGN ROMGAZ SA completed the installation of an offshore production platform to establish regional digital infrastructure and energy processing capacity in the Black Sea.

OMV Petrom and SNGN ROMGAZ SA have finalized the installation of the Neptun Alpha offshore platform for the Neptun Deep project in the Black Sea. The infrastructure supports deepwater extraction, gas treatment, and subsea integration for the Domino and Pelican South gas fields.
Joint Operational Framework and Roles
The project is executed as a joint venture between OMV Petrom and SNGN ROMGAZ SA to manage the engineering, fabrication, and marine installation requirements of the deepwater development. The complex operating environment in water depths of approximately 120 meters required combining technical resources for offshore logistics, subsea drilling, and transport infrastructure.
Fabriation of the platform components was handled by contractor Saipem across two facilities: the support jacket was fabricated in Arbatax, Italy, while the platform topsides were constructed in Karimun, Indonesia.
Platform Architecture and Technical Specifications
The Neptun Alpha platform functions as the central offshore hub for processing natural gas prior to onshore transmission. The combined structure weighs 16,500 metric tons and reaches a total height exceeding 225 meters.
Installation relied on the semi-submersible crane vessel Saipem 7000 for positioning and lifting. Technical parameters and structural specifications include:
- Foundation System: Eight steel piles, each exceeding two meters in diameter, driven into the seabed to anchor the jacket structure.
- Automation Standard: Fully automated topside processing units designed for remote operations without permanent on-site crew.
- Maintenance Logistics: Support via a dedicated operation and maintenance vessel capable of accommodating up to 90 personnel during service interventions.
Subsea Integration and Infrastructure Development
The platform interfaces directly with broader subsea production systems and transport networks. The complete offshore pipeline routing connects ten production wells across the Domino and Pelican South fields to subsea production systems and collector pipelines. Gas flows directly to the Neptun Alpha platform for processing before entering a 160-kilometer main offshore transport pipeline that delivers the gas directly to the onshore gas measurement station at Tuzla.
The 160-kilometer main pipeline connecting the offshore facility to the onshore terminal at Tuzla has been laid. To date, six of the ten planned development wells have been drilled. Next implementation phases involve completing the remaining wells, installing interfield subsea pipelines, and conducting integrated system commissioning tests prior to operational startup.
